'America's Next Top Model' Cycle 16 - Episode 8 - Time for Go-sees

Last week on America's Next Top Model, the models had a photo shoot for Ford's Warriors in Pink campaign. Nigel Barker was the photographer, and also decided the winner, who was Alexandria. Alexandria's challenge win allowed her to shoot a PSA for Warriors in Pink which would be viewed on the Ford website. She also won a 2012 Ford Focus. This decision really got to Brittani, who thought that Alexandria was not a good role model, and shouldn't have won the challenge. She voiced her opinion on set to the other models, and had words with Alexandria, all the while, with Nigel Barker watching.

Later, the girls headed off to Universal Studios for a shoot outside the Psycho set, where they had to portray women who were crazy for various types of fashion. At panel, Jaclyn ended up with first call-out, while Brittani and Mikaela ended up in the bottom two. Mikaela ended up going home. Who will go home this week? Read on.

This week, after panel, the bus didn't take the models home, but instead to an art galley, where the girls met with Tyra. Tyra had a display of framed pictures that contained each of the girls' portfolios. Tyra explained the importance of how to set up a portfolio, with a large beauty shot at the beginning, and a picture that wows the potential client at the end. She went over the various girls' portfolios, explaining that it doesn't matter how many photos you have. They just have to be amazing. She also held up a mysterious letter "C," saying it was part of the name of the international destination that the girls would be going. The rest of the letters are in the girl's individual portfolios. They put all the letters together to find out they'd be going to Morocco. Unfortunately, Tyra tells them that only 5 of the girls will be going to Morocco. Tomorrow, they will be going on go-sees, and the results of the go-sees will weigh heavily on who goes to Morocco, and who goes home.

The next day, as the girls were getting ready to go on their go-sees, Kyle Hagler from IMG models shows up at the door. He explains that they will have 4 hours to see 4 potential clients. Each client will represent a different archetype -- bombshell, girl-next-door, couture, and athletic. They will need to pack bags for each type of casting. Cars are ready for them downstairs, with a driver, but the girls will have to use maps to get around L.A.. They can't ask the driver or anyone else for directions. They will need to be at Lana Marks store by 3:00 pm, where the top 3 girls will participate in a final, very important go-see with Lana Marks.

Alexandria has an advantage, being that she is from Los Angeles, and she knows her way around really well. Molly, on the other hand, is having a problem finding the addresses. Jaclyn also has problems, as she's really bad with maps. The closest location, Frankie B. jeans (bombshell archetype) seems to be the location everyone seems to choose as their first stop. Molly arrives last, and decides she doesn't want to wait, so she takes back off and goes to another House Casting (girl-next-door archetype), where she has to memorize a commercial.

Back at Frankie B. jeans, Alexandria, Hannah, Kasia and Jaclyn all seem to impress the designer. At the House Casting, Molly has her first go-see, where she fails to impress the casting agent, who thinks she could be more friendly. Alexandria shows up just after Molly, and nails the go-see with House Casting.

The couture go-see is with Oday Shakar, where Kasia arrives and impresses the designer, who thinks that she would impress his clients. Brittani also makes it to the couture go-see, and she also impresses the designer with her look and her walk.

Jaclyn finally makes her second go-see, which is the girl-next-door archetype at House Casting. Hannah reads there as well, and the client comments on Jaclyn's accent, saying it might be a problem with certain jobs. No comment is given about Hannah's reading.

Molly hits her second casting, which is at the Smashbox Studios, with photographer Jerry Avenaim. This is the sports archetype. Unfortunately, Molly forgot to pack athletic gear, and she makes it work, rolling up her tank top, and wears her booty shorts. The photographer is super impressed, and would only be happier, if Molly had come prepared in the proper gear.Alexandria also makes it to the atheletic archetype casting, and she has remembered to bring a swimsuit, so she is prepared. She runs out to the car, and changes into her suit, leaving on her shorts, and then runs back in. As with her other go-sees, the photographer thought she was great, and would book her.

Both Brittani and Jaclyn decide after only making it to 2 go-sees, that they will head to Lana Marks, so they are certain to be on time. Both girls had time navigating L.A., and didn't want to take the chance they'd get lost. Soon, Hannah and Kasia also arrive at Lana Marks, and with 9 minutes remaining, in strolls Molly. Still no Alexandria. As the clock ticks down, with only 30 seconds to spare, in walks Alexandria.

Kyle Hagler from IMG addresses the girls to tell them how they did. The three girls that did the best, were Molly, Alexandria and Kasia. Of the girls that weren't in the top 3, Kyle tells Hannah that her runway walk needed a lot of work, and Brittani and Jaclyn only made it to 2 go-sees, which doesn't cut it. They are asked to leave, and Lana Marks enters to talk with the top 3 girls. She tells them the one that impresses her most will be in her next campaign, which will be seen in over 100 countries. The winner will also receive a gift bag of goodies from all the participating designers from the go-sees, and she'll get a replica of the Cleopatra clutch worn by Angelina Jolie to the 2010 Oscars, which is valued at $2,000.

Each of the girls has to pose for Lana, and she asks them each what it would mean to them to be part of the campaign. After all is said and done, Lana picks Alexandria as the winner.

Later at the model home, the girls receive a Tyra mail!

"A modeling career is a terrible thing to waste. Love, Tyra"

The next day, the girls are driven to the "Olinda Alpha Landfill," where they meet Mr. Jay and Nigel Barker. They tell the girls that they'll be shooting at the landfill, wearing eco-friendly clothing that was made especially for each of them by Michael Cinco.

During the shoot, Nigel comments that Kasia was having problems with her facial expressions. Nigel thinks Jaclyn has great control of her body, but she too needs to work on her face. Mr. Jay thinks that Hannah needs to stop second guessing herself, as it leads to inconsistent photos. Mr. Jay loves Alexandria at her photo shoot. She is giving him a broken down feel that goes well with the shot. Nigel notices Molly complaining about the location and the birds, and thinks she does well when she is being shot, but when she's off, she is very unprofessional. Brittani does really well, even offering to get down on the ground, which really impresses Mr. Jay.

Back at the model home, after the shoot, the girls receive the elimination Tyra mail!

"Tomorrow you will meet with the judges. Only 5 will continue on in the hope of becoming America's Next Top Model."

At panel, Tyra introduces the judges, which includes guest judge, Lana Marks, tells them about the prizes, and then gets on with the judging.

First to be critiqued is Alexandria. She booked 4 of 4 of her go-sees. The designers thought that she was prepared and friendly, and Tyra points out that this is exactly what you should do on a go-see. When the judges look at Alexandria's photo, Tyra calls it true high fashion. Lana says that her face and expression says it all. ALT calls her the star of the picture.

Next is Jaclyn. Tyra asks her how many go-sees she went to. Jaclyn says that she only made it to 2, due to having difficulty getting around. Lana Marks chastises her, saying that this is a chance of a lifetime, and it's totally unacceptable. Tyra gives Jaclyn the good news that she did book both of her go-sees, so that is a positive thing. They look at her photo, and Nigel comments that she needs to relax her jaw. She does well with posing her body, but her facial expressions need work. ALT thinks her left hand looks gauche.

Next is Molly. She went to 4 of the 5 go-sees, and booked 2 of them. The feedback from the designers was that they loved her look and her portfolio, but thought she came across cold and not present when she thought she was not being judged. Nigel agreed that during the photo shoot, she was great when she was being shot, but in between she would have off moments. Tyra tells Molly that if she had had a more consistent positive attitude, she would have been the winner of the Lana Marks challenge. Nigel thinks Molly's photo is gorgeous, and ALT thinks it's very editorial and dramatic.

Kasiais next. She went to 4 of the 5 go-sees, and she booked 2 of them. Tyra said the feedback said that she engaged the people to be sure they remembered her, but she came off rather rehearsed. When looking at Kasia's shot, Lana remarks that she thought she looked amazing. She loved the mystical look on her face. Tyra commented that while the shot is lovely, on a whole it seemed that she didn't seem to be moving in her shots. She also thinks that Kasia needs to learn what poses are best for her body.

Hannah is next. She went to 3 of the 5 go-sees. The feedback was that she came off young, fresh and glowing. But, she also came off green and inexperienced, and struggled with her runway walk. In looking at her picture, Lana loves her posture. Nigel tells her that she is wearing the dress. The dress is not wearing her. Tyra says that Hannah did really well, but she has a problem with doubting herself. She needs to catch up with what her abilities are.

Brittani is next, and Tyra asks her how she's feeling since last week. Brittani apologized for her behavior and told Tyra that she also apologized to Alexandria, and everything is all cool with them all. She went to only 2 go-sees, and she told Tyra that she takes the blame for that, and thinks her biggest problem was going on the freeway. Tyra tells her that she booked both jobs. When looking at her shot, ALT calls the shot so high fashion and so editorial. Tyra comments that she really worked it, but she needs to watch it so that her neck muscles don't get really stiff.

The judges deliberate, and the call-outs are as follows:

1.      Alexandria

2.      Hannah

3.      Kasia

4.      Brittani

Molly and Jaclyn are in the bottom two. The judges are worried that Jaclyn only made it to 2 go-sees. The good thing is that she booked both of them. But again, it was only 2. Molly made it to 4 out of 5, but only booked 2, due to her personality. Who stays? Molly will stay, and Jaclyn will be heading back to Texas.
